#a98bd1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a98bd1 is composed of 66.3% red, 54.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 68.2%. #a98bd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5317a3.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a98bd1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a98bd1 has RGB values of R:169, G:139,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 11111377.

Hex triplet a98bd1 #a98bd1
RGB Decimal 169, 139, 209 rgb(169,139,209)
RGB Percent 66.3, 54.5, 82 rgb(66.3%,54.5%,82%)
CMYK 19, 33, 0, 18
HSL 265.7°, 43.2, 68.2 hsl(265.7,43.2%,68.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 265.7°, 33.5, 82
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 62.931, 25.198, -31.834
XYZ 37.102, 31.504, 64.444
xyY 0.279, 0.237, 31.504
CIE-LCH 62.931, 40.599, 308.363
CIE-LUV 62.931, 10.853, -53.185
Hunter-Lab 56.128, 19.766, -28.785
Binary 10101001, 10001011, 11010001

Shades and Tints of #a98bd1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040a is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.
